What is the meaning of the word 'pellucid'

pellucid - transparent; limpid; easy to understand


Some sentence examples which use the word 'pellucid'

  • The swimming pool in the school is so pellucid that the tiles at the bottom are clearly visible.
  • Perforatum, small shrubby plants with slender stems, sessile opposite leaves which are often dotted with pellucid glands, and showy yellow flowers.
  • The St Lawrence varies only a few feet in the year and always has pellucid bluish-green water, while the Mississippi, whose tributaries begin only a short distance south of the Great Lakes, varies 40 f t.
